Description

The Department of Justice's Office of Adjudication, Recruitment and Management is submitting a revision request for the electronic application collection for the Attorney General's Honors Program and the Summer Law Intern Program. The collection involves candidates entering legal employment information electronically, which is then reviewed and transmitted for hiring consideration. The revision includes deletions of certain questions and maintains the voluntary nature of the application process. The estimated annual burden is 3,425 hours with an estimated federal cost of $71,492.
